Team Umizoomi Emoji,Team Umizoomi Logo

Team Umizoomi Emoji,Team Umizoomi Logo
Resolution: 815 x 486
Downloads: 0
Views: 27
Likes: 0
Size: 339.21 KB
Upload Time: 2021-11-04 09:13:17
License: Free for personal and commercial purpose with attribution